The Easy Way to Infuse Caffeine into a DIY Serum…

An extremely easy way to enjoy the benefits of a coffee infused oil is to simply add a couple of coffee beans to an anti aging carrier oil such as rosehip seed oil, moringa oil, sweet almond oil, marula oil etc. and allow the infusion to happen over a few days. No heat is required just time. Over a couple of days, you will notice your product will begin to have the lovely aroma of coffee. Plus, you don’t even have to remove the beans!

DIY Caffeine Eye Serum Roll On:

  • 1 tsp. Rosehip Seed Oil (find it HERE)
  • 1/2 tsp. Moringa Oil (find it HERE)
  • 1/4 tsp. Vitamin E Oil (find it HERE)
  • 2-3 Organic Coffee Beans

Directions:

  1. Use a small funnel to add each ingredient into a 10ml roll on bottle like THIS one. 
  2. You can use immediately but the coffee beans will take a day or two to infuse. 
  3. You can remove the coffee beans after a week if you like. I left mine in and ended up with a very weird smelling roll on. I also originally used 6 coffee beans and found that to be entirely too strong. 

To Use:

Gently roll around the eyes morning and night to reduce puffiness, reduce the appearance of dark circles and hydrate the delicate tissue around the eyes.
